Output 156e52535e48f7758955aac70669321ad1d1c810e0dece608c705d1f5a587425:54

value
14306
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bcdbd5e447f5cd0717fcf1191db39710471d75052564da19e0a0464ea8f5bb57
address
bc1phndatez87hxsw9lu7yv3mvuhzpr36ag9y4jd5x0q5prya284hdtspf8808
transaction
156e52535e48f7758955aac70669321ad1d1c810e0dece608c705d1f5a587425
spent
true